#212 (Motor Disabled): The motor disabled advisory will identify that electric
motor operation was stopped by the controller. A fault should have been
generated that will provide additional information as to cause of the issue.
#213 (Disengage Traction): This advisory notifies the operator that the bail
lever is engaged and needs to be released before operation can be continued.
The disengage traction advisory will be displayed if the machine is turned on
with the traction bail already engaged.
#214 (Battery Temperature Too Low): This advisory notifies that the battery
operating temperature is too low, and the controller was denied the motor
operation.
#215 (Battery Temperature Too High): This advisory notifies that the battery
operating temperature is too high, and the controller was denied the motor
operation.
#216 (Battery Voltage Too High): This advisory notifies that the battery
operating voltage is too high, and the controller was denied the motor operation.
#217 (Battery Draw Too High): This advisory notifies an over current situation,
and the controller was denied the motor operation.
